109 + buyers premium of 12.5% plus VAT (15% incl VAT) on the first £300,000 of the hammer and 10% plus VAT (12% incl VAT) thereafter Lot 473 2005 GT40 (CAV) Cape Advanced Vehicles (CAV) are widely respected globally for producing high-quality GT40 recreations. Based in Cape Town, South Africa, the company has been manufacturing GT40 recreations continuously for 30 years using a unique stainless steel chassis and their cars are almost impossible to source here in the UK. Offered here is a GT40 recreation manufactured in 2005 by CAV and finished in Le Mans Blue with classic white GT40 racing Stripes. The engine is a new crated small-block FORD V8 302 with an Aluminium head, performance inlet manifold and Holley twin-barrel 650cfm carburettor generating a power output of over 400 bhp and featuring a classic ‘bundle of snakes’ exhaust system under a glass screen in the rear bodywork. A 5-speed Audi Turbo gearbox finishes the drivetrain which is the recognised as the stock choice for high-quality GT40 builds. A fully independent rose-jointed adjustable suspension set up with Wilwood brakes and original look 15-inch GT40 knock off alloys wearing BF Goodrich Radial tyres provides traction, handling and stopping power. The cabin space is full leather with dashboard and original look leather eyelet seats. The seating position is currently set up to accommodate a driver up to 6’3” but can be modified to suit and netted door pockets provide useful storage space. All the period-style matching Smiths gauges are present with a digital speedo, 3-spoke leather steering wheel with a ‘Ford Racing’ centre, and a laser-cut engraved signature of Jacky Ickx, 5 times Le Mans winner, on the dash. Air conditioning and a heater are fitted and the 4-point racing harnesses/seatbelts are by Sparco. This car has had one South African owner from new and was imported and used by its UK GT40 enthusiast owner since 2019 with limited use and always dry stored correctly.
